Title: | A modified groundwater module in SWAT for improved streamflow simulation in a large, arid endorheic River watershed in northwest China |
Authors: | Jin, X., C. He, L. Zhang and B. Zhang |
Year: | 2018 |
Journal: | Chinese Geographical Science |
Volume (Issue): | 28(1) |
Pages: | 47-60 |
Article ID: | |
DOI: | 10.1007/s11769-018-0931-0 |
URL (non-DOI journals): | |
Model: | SWAT (modified) & SWAT |
Broad Application Category: | hydrologic only |
Primary Application Category: | groundwater and/or soil water impacts |
Secondary Application Category: | irrigation impacts or irrigation BMP scenarios |
Watershed Description: | 130,000 km^2 Heihe River, located in northwest China. |
